I love this foundation, I use it every day. It stays put, and provides enough coverage for me without looking like I am "made-up". I apply over mac prep + prime, and if I wanna go a little fancier, I set it with their inner-light loose powder. This is the only foundation I have found which has actually helped my skin look better, rather then breaking me out, which you gotta love. I also am so happy that they changed their packaging to include the little pump, which makes it a lot easier for me to get the product out. My only problem with it is that it is a little hard for me to find a perfect color match (they turn out a little pinkish sometimes on my olive skin) What I do is mix a little bit of their lightest shade (vanilla-01) with the shade that is a tiny bit too dark for me (Desert-06) and I can get the perfect color that just melts into my face. It's a bit more expensive to buy two and time consuming to mix, but not too bad and it's totally worht it to me for the result I get!
EDIT: I still really love this foundation, but my skin is better now and it was just too time consuming and expensive. I don't do it for everyday wear, but sometimes for special occasions I'll break out what I have left over.

I bought this foundation over a week ago and have been using it every day. I must say…I am very impressed. It is a very light gel like formula that I find sinks right into my skin. It covers well (although I still use concealer on some of my acne scars) and blends like a dream. I have been skipping the moisturizer step in my skin care routine and I notice that when I do this foundation is a bit harder to blend but the finish is much better….almost dewy but not greasy. In the summer I am too oily for moisturizer so I look for a liquid foundation that has a hint of moisture without being too heavy and I think I found it with this one. I am NW20 and flax is a perfect match. This product has a slight lavender smell which I enjoy but it does fade quickly for those sensitive to scents. I do NOT have great skin and I got 2 compliments while wearing this foundation. One thing I did notice is that it does get streaky if you apply it over a moisturizer…..I dealt with this by gently buffing my face with a sponge once the foundation had set. The SA recommended I set this with a powder but I do not feel that is needed as I am looking for a dewy / natural look. Overall this is a fantastic foundation…I’m going back to try more aveda products!

I have a really hard time finding a good color match, so finding Wheat which is a great match for me NC35 skin was a great begining. I love how this goes on. It's very thick in the bottle (which to me makes no sense... how do you get such a thick, gel like foundation out of a bottle without sticking something inside??). But once applied to skin, it goes on fairly sheer. It evens out my skin nicely and looks very, very natural. A bit glowy but with no sparkly bits. I use Bamboo concealor with in to cover acne scars and dust MAC MSF powder on top. And voila! Great looking skin. Most liquid foundations make my otherwise small pores look enlarged. I've tried EVERYTHING, and I know this gets a lot of bad reviews here, but try it. FYI - the lippie I took off was for the packaging, otherwise it would have been 5.EDIT: Its breaking me out :((
